A while back, Jessica's American Girl Doll, began losing her hair. It was the strangest thing, but the extensions were literally falling right off. I was so mad. Jessica was thrilled!
She'd been wanting to have an excuse to send her doll to the "American Girl Doll Hospital" (yes...there really is such a place) and it looked like now was the time. So, despite my annoyance with having to pack it up and ship it off (I'm too used to our digital world, as writing out an address and slapping on postage was just about too much;) we started the process of getting her doll fixed.
First, I had to go online and print out her "admitting papers."
Then we sent her off.
Jessica cried for nights wondering where her doll was, and I couldn't help but worry that we'd never see her doll again.
A few weeks later though, we received little "ponyo" (Jessica named her?) arrived healthy and well. She came back to us in a hospital gown, a medical ID bracelet, a get well card, an official prescription for some TLC, and a new head of hair.
Jessica was beyond excited. Well one American Girl Doll Co. Well done!
